It is almost certain the likes of Antonio, Cresswell and Ings will be offered new contracts, whether they accept them or not is a different matter. We will be desperately short on Home Grown Players next season, the 3 above are all classed as home grown as is Johnson and Anang who will both be likely to leave at the end of the season, Coventry was another who was home grown, he´s already gone. To be able to have full 25 player squad we need 8 home growns. At present we have the five above plus Bowen and JWP.
A nightmare scenario ...... if all five left. as there is a premium price on homegrown players even with limited ability and very few of our U21 eligible.
